Highlights

  • In 2009, Cast as writer Jonathan Ames, who moonlights as a private detective in the HBO drama series, "Bored to Death"
  • In 2009, Played egotistical actor, Mark Taylor Jackson in Judd Apatow's "Funny People"
  • In 2007, Re-teamed with director Wes Anderson for the film, "The Darjeeling Limited"; also co-wrote with Anderson
